Your back and chest are like your face, they have pores and those pores get clogged.
If you’re a teen or in your 20s, acne is normal, its because your body produces to much oil.
Wash your face, chest and back twice a day, get a toner that has witch hazel in it, you can take this with you to school and during lunch go to the bathroom and use the toner on your back, and chest, if you wear make-up then don’t worry about using it on your face, washing it twice a day will suffice.
If it is affecting your life that much, you can go to a dermatologist for treatment options.
